Transaction b72fa038156f210521a5d116b2d7de6ee86d74d16a7fdcc91fbac5e3d91f84fd
1 Input
2 Outputs
- b72fa038156f210521a5d116b2d7de6ee86d74d16a7fdcc91fbac5e3d91f84fd:0
- b72fa038156f210521a5d116b2d7de6ee86d74d16a7fdcc91fbac5e3d91f84fd:1
value 670180
address 3FXxLnVaYwpKX6dBf2QGhR7KCgQ2QtRsiY
value 14610589
address 1BAo5KTJWS7nSvmXA2oeECqUpN7CF2xMtJ